详情介绍
在当今的互联网时代,网页的加载速度对于用户体验和网站的成功至关重要。Google Chrome 作为一款广泛使用的浏览器,提供了一些强大的工具和功能来帮助开发者优化网页的动态加载性能。本文将详细介绍如何利用 Google Chrome 来提升网页的动态加载性能,让你的网站更加快速、流畅地展现给用户。
一、启用浏览器缓存
浏览器缓存是一种存储网页资源(如图片、脚本、样式表等)的技术,使得在后续访问相同网页时,可以直接从本地缓存中读取这些资源,而无需再次从服务器下载,从而大大提高了页面加载速度。
要启用 Google Chrome 的浏览器缓存,只需按照以下步骤操作:
1. 打开 Google Chrome 浏览器。
2. 点击右上角的菜单按钮,选择“设置”选项。
3. 在“隐私与安全”部分中,点击“站点设置”。
4. 找到“缓存”选项,确保其设置为“自动”,这样浏览器就会根据需要自动缓存网页资源。
二、使用内容分发网络(CDN)
CDN 是一种分布式服务器系统,它可以根据用户的位置将网页内容从距离最近的服务器传输给用户,从而减少数据传输时间,提高页面加载速度。
要使用 CDN 来提升网页的动态加载性能,你需要完成以下步骤:
1. 选择一个可靠的 CDN 服务提供商,如 Cloudflare、阿里云 CDN 等。
2. 注册并登录到所选的 CDN 服务提供商账户。
3. 按照提供商的说明,将你的网站域名添加到 CDN 服务中,并进行相应的配置。
4. 在你的网站代码中,将静态资源的引用路径修改为 CDN 提供的链接,以便从 CDN 服务器获取这些资源。
三、优化 JavaScript 和 CSS 文件
JavaScript 和 CSS 文件是网页的重要组成部分,但过多的或未经优化的脚本和样式表会导致页面加载缓慢。以下是一些优化 JavaScript 和 CSS 文件的方法:
(一)合并和压缩文件
1. 合并多个小的 JavaScript 和 CSS 文件为一个文件,可以减少浏览器请求次数,提高加载速度。
2. 使用压缩工具对 JavaScript 和 CSS 文件进行压缩,去除不必要的空格、注释等,减小文件大小。
(二)延迟加载非关键资源
对于一些不是立即显示在屏幕上的资源,如图片轮播、视频等,可以采用延迟加载的方式,在用户滚动到页面相应位置时才加载这些资源,避免一次性加载过多资源导致页面卡顿。
(三)将 JavaScript 放在底部加载
默认情况下,浏览器会阻塞页面的渲染,直到所有的 JavaScript 文件都加载完毕。因此,将 JavaScript 文件放在页面底部,可以让浏览器先加载和渲染 HTML 和 CSS 内容,再执行 JavaScript 代码,从而提高页面的初始加载速度。
四、优化图像资源
图像通常是网页中占用带宽最大的元素之一,优化图像可以显著提高网页的加载速度。以下是一些优化图像的方法:
(一)选择合适的图像格式
不同的图像格式适用于不同类型的图像内容。例如,JPEG 适合照片等色彩丰富的图像,PNG 适合图标、透明图像等,WebP 则是一种更先进的图像格式,具有更高的压缩比和更好的图像质量。根据图像的特点选择合适的格式,可以有效减小图像文件大小。
(二)调整图像尺寸
在使用图像之前,应根据实际需要调整图像的尺寸,避免上传过大的原始图像。过大的图像不仅会增加文件大小,还会在缩放时导致图像模糊。可以使用图像编辑工具对图像进行裁剪和调整尺寸,以确保图像在网页上显示清晰且文件大小合适。
(三)使用懒加载技术
懒加载是一种延迟加载图像的技术,当用户滚动到页面上的某个位置时,才加载该位置的图像。这样可以在页面初次加载时减少图像的请求数量,提高页面加载速度。可以通过添加一些简单的 JavaScript 代码来实现图像的懒加载效果。
五、利用浏览器开发者工具进行性能分析
Google Chrome 提供了强大的开发者工具,可以帮助你分析网页的性能瓶颈并进行优化。以下是使用 Chrome 开发者工具进行性能分析的基本步骤:
1. 打开 Google Chrome 浏览器,按下 F12 键或右键单击页面,选择“检查”打开开发者工具。
2. 切换到“性能”面板,点击“录制”按钮开始记录页面的加载过程。
3. 完成页面加载后,停止录制。开发者工具会生成一份详细的性能报告,其中包括各种资源的加载时间、请求次数等信息。
4. 根据性能报告中的数据,找出加载时间较长的资源或存在性能问题的部分,然后针对性地进行优化。
通过以上方法,你可以有效地利用 Google Chrome 来提升网页的动态加载性能,为用户提供更快、更流畅的浏览体验。同时,持续关注网站的加载速度和性能表现,并根据用户反馈和数据分析进行不断优化,也是保持网站竞争力的重要手段。希望本文能帮助你在网站优化的道路上取得更好的成果。